We are seeking a dedicated and passionate Registered Nurse (RN), to join our skilled nursing team. As a Registered Nurse
, you will play a vital role in providing high quality care, supporting our residents health and well-being, and guiding our nursing teams to ensure exceptional outcomes!

Registered Nurse (RN) Duties, Responsibilities &

Qualifications:
  • Provide direct patient care and oversee delivery of nursing services.
  • Administer medications and treatments in accordance with physician orders and facility policies.
  • Monitor patient progress, update care plans, and maintain accurate files and documentation.
  • Hold an active, unencumbered Registered Nurse (RN) state license.
  • Demonstrate strong clinical judgement, critical thinking, and leadership skills.
  • Communicate effectively and professionally.
  • Previous experience as a nurse in long-term or skilled care is preferred, but not a requirement.
